Problem Statement

Let ABCABC be a triangle with A=80o\angle A = 80^o and C=30o\angle C = 30^o. Consider the point MM inside the triangle ABCABC so that MAC=60o\angle MAC= 60^o and MCA=20o\angle MCA = 20^o. If NN is the intersection of the lines BMBM and ACAC to show that a MNMN is the bisector of the angle AMC\angle AMC.
